Lee County homeowners file Form DR-486 with the Value Adjustment Board within 25 days of the TRIM notice. Cape Coral, Fort Myers, and Estero petitions rely on neighborhood comps; post-Ian condition and insurance documentation strengthen the informal review.
Deadline
25 days after the TRIM notice (mailed mid-August)
Form
Form DR-486 filed with the VAB

What works in Lee County
Lee County still adjudicates many post-Hurricane Ian condition claims; submit dated repair invoices and FEMA flood-zone data.
Across Florida, the strongest single-family appeals pair three to five recent comparable assessments with documented property condition. See the evidence and comps guide for what the VAB special magistrate will weigh.
